In the café, old Dragomír is happy to tell stories of his adventurous life if he is paid a drink. This time it goes about his youth spent in Braila, Romania. His beautiful but jealously guarded mother and his elder sister were surrounded by a multitude of suitors, dance and revelry intolerable for his father and elderly brothers. Once they were against them so wildly that they had to flee with Dragomír. From this time on their ways were separate. Dragomír met Codin, the ill-famed former prisoner lad, who accepted him to be his blood-brother, and treated him accordingly, even during the great cholera epidemy. Due to his jealousy Codin found himself in jail soon again and Dragomír was taken by a Turk, called Nazim, to Istambul, where he was sexually abused. He never again saw his mother and he could spot his sister only once, passing in a coach. (official distributor synopsis)
